10/0 Delica Beads (DBM)

Miyuki size 10/0 Delica beads, sometimes called "meduim" Delicas (DBM), measure 2.3 x 1.2mm. DBM beads are precisely cut tubes of glass with a rounded outer surface and flat ends. Slightly larger than 11/0 Delica beads, medium Delicas have the same uniform shape and consistent size, making them popular with bead artists. With a generous hole size of 1mm DBM beads are perfect for a variety stitching techniques including: peyote, brick, herringbone and square. There are approximately 108 beads per gram and 14 beads per inch.

Delica beads are traditionally used for loom weaving where their flat ends allow them to fit neatly together, creating a beautifully smooth surface and clear image. When used in Peyote stitch DBM beads stack together like bricks, building firm tension while remaing flexible. The hole diameter of 10/0 Delicas is large in proportion to their size, making them extremely versatile and easy to use with many beading techniques.

Miyuki size 10/0 Delica beads are available in over 250 brilliant colors. The dazzling finishes include: transparent, opaque, sparkling color lined, metaillic, Duracoat, silverlined alabaster, silk satin and luminous. Medium Delicas are also available in a seven sided cut bead (DBMC). These multi faceted beads add sparkle and texture to any design. DBMC beads come in over 40 colors and finishes giving you even more creative options!
